BRIE, REDCURRANT, AND WATERCRESS TOASTIE
Make and share this Brie, Redcurrant, and Watercress Toastie recipe from Food.com.
Provided by hectorthebat
Categories Lunch/Snacks
Time 13m
Yield 1 round
Number Of Ingredients 5
Steps:
- Preheat the sandwich toaster to its highest setting.
- Slice the Brie and cover one of the pieces of bread with it. Spread over the redcurrant jelly and sprinkle on the watercress leaves. Add a twist of black pepper and cover with the second slice of bread. Place the sandwich in the toaster (Brie side uppermost), close the lid, and cook for 3 minutes until crisp and golden.

BAKED BRIE WITH JAM IN PUFF PASTRY
Serve this decadent yet easy appetizer with apple wedges and crackers and watch it disappear in seconds! It's bound to be your new party go-to.
Provided by Carolyn Casner
Categories Low-Carb Appetizer Recipes
Time 50m
Number Of Ingredients 4
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 400 degrees F.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
- Lay puff pastry on the prepared baking sheet. Place Brie in the center. Spread jam over the top. Fold the pastry up and over the Brie, pleating as necessary to enclose it. Gently pinch the dough together at the center to seal. Flip the Brie over so the pastry is seam-side down. Brush the pastry with oil.
- Bake until nicely browned, 30 to 35 minutes. Let cool for 5 to 10 minutes and serve warm.

CURRANT TEA BREAD
This rich and flavorful bread is a favorite old-time recipe. Because it keeps well and goes great with coffee or tea, I like to have an extra loaf on hand for gifts or for friends who come to call over the holidays.
Provided by Taste of Home
Time 1h10m
Yield 1 loaf.
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- In a large bowl, cream butter and sugar. Add the eggs, one at a time, beating well after each addition. Beat in the milk and lemon zest. Combine flour and baking powder; gradually add to the creamed mixture and mix well. Stir in currants., Transfer to a greased 9x5-in. loaf pan. Bake at 350° for 55-60 minutes or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ean. Cool for 10 minutes before removing from pan to a wire rack.

BRIE, LEMON CURD, AND BLUEBERRY BITES
Looking for a quick and easy appetizer/snack made with minimal effort that will WOW your guests? These bites are buttery, creamy, cheesy, and balanced out with tart lemon curd and a sweet pop of flavor from blueberries. Finger food at its best!
Provided by lutzflcat
Categories Cheese Appetizers
Time 45m
Yield 24
Number Of Ingredients 7
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C). Spray a mini muffin tin with cooking spray and set aside.
- Unroll thawed puff pastry sheet on a lightly floured work surface. Roll into a large rectangular sheet, and using a pizza cutter or knife, cut into 24 equal pieces. Press each piece into a muffin cup, and use a fork to prick the bottom several times.
- Cut Brie cheese into 24 small cubes, and place a cube into each muffin cup. Top each with about 1/2 teaspoon of lemon curd.
- Place muffin tin in the preheated oven and bake until the pastry is puffed and the corners turn golden brown, 12 to 14 minutes.
- Remove from the oven and cool in the pan for about 5 minutes. Remove bites to a serving plate, top each with a blueberry, dust with confectioners' sugar, and garnish with a small mint leaf, if desired.
- Enjoy warm or at room temperature.
